    2 En What is MP3? “MP3 (MPEG-1 Audio Layer-3)” is a standard technology and format for compressing an audio sequence into a small- sized file. However , the original level of sound quality is preserved during playback.     English 15 En To cancel the index searc h function Press INDEX . Notes ● Not all discs hav e index numbers. In addition, among those discs which hav e index numbers, not all discs necessarily hav e more than one index number . ● The index system is a method for sub-di viding tracks into smaller divisions for easier loca tion of those parts.
